BARCELONA DEMO DAY 2017: AND THE WINNER IS…A WEARABLE TO PREVENT EPILEPSY

It was a geat day, full of highly innovative business ideas. The judges Karolina Korth (Roche), Iolanda Marchueta (Astrazeneca) and Àlex Casta (Caixa Capital Risk) decided among 10 startups to give the first place to MJN Neuroserveis: a wearable solution to prevent epilepsy seizures. Empowering science-based entrepreneurship in Barcelona

In the last 15 years, Barcelona has become one of the most important cities in life sciences and technology research.
